A state ethics investigation has cleared Pinellas Property Appraiser Jim Smith and other county officials of wrongdoing in a controversial land deal between Smith and the county. The report by the Florida Ethics Commission, released Wednesday, also cleared former Pinellas County Attorney Susan Churuti and County Commissioner Ronnie Duncan. ...more

CLEARWATER - Meet the new boss. Same as the old boss. Former Pinellas County Administrator Fred Marquis, a fixture at the county courthouse for decades, is the county commission's unanimous selection to temporarily replace County Administrator Steve Spratt. Spratt, the county's top appointed official for nearly six years, is resigning at the end of this month amid political fallout over the county's controversial purchase of land from Property Appraiser Jim Smith. ...more
